C. Review and discuss HARC purpose and approve recently adopted bylaws. Karen Frost,
Recording Secretary
Motion by Commissioner Eason to accept the bylaws with the change of the title Section 2.3
Appointment of Commission members and Commissioner -in -Training members since there
are no longer Commissioners in Training, but are now Alternates. Second by Commissioner
Bohls. Approved. 7 - 0.
There was discussion that this would change the dynamics of the meeting and that the naming
of the alternates was not correct. Alternates are no longer "in -training' but will serve on the
dais when any regular member has to be away from their seat, either with absence or recusal.

H Public Hearing and Possible Action on a request for a Certificate of Appropriateness (COA) for
exterior alterations for the property located at 1226 South Church Street bearing the legal
description of Morrow Addition, Block D -E (PTS), 0.466 acres (COA-2017-005)
Matt Synatschk provided an overview of the Certificate of Appropriateness application request
and description of project. Staff recommends approval as presented.
Vice -chair Bain invited the applicant to speak. Applicant stated he will be glad to answer any
questions.
Vice -chair Bain opened the Public Hearing. No one came forward, the Open Hearing was
closed.
Motion by Commissioner Eason to approve the request for a Certificate of Appropriateness
(COA) for exterior alterations for the property located at 1226 South Church Street bearing
the legal description of Morrow Addition, Block D -E (PTS), 0.466 acres. Second by
Commissioner Romero. Approved. 7-0
Conceptual Review for a proposed Infill Project located at 810 Rock Street (Downtown, Area 2) -
Matt Synatschk
Staff along with Mr. Pfiester gave a brief history and presentation of the proposal and asked for
input from the commissioners. Discussion between Mr. Pfiester and the commissioners.
Commissioner Eason stated she is concerned with the parking. She suggested full size parking
spaces and not have any spaces for compact cars only.
